Title: Young Bae Seo: Innovator in Optical Fiber Technology

Introduction

Young Bae Seo is a prominent inventor based in Chungcheongbuk-do, South Korea. He has made significant contributions to the field of optical fiber technology, holding a total of four patents. His innovative designs have advanced the efficiency and functionality of optical fiber processing equipment.

Latest Patents

Seo's latest patents include an optical fiber fusion splicer and a portable optical fiber processing apparatus. The optical fiber fusion splicer features a body with a joining part that connects the ends of two optical fibers. It also includes a heating part to fuse a sleeve pipe to the optical fibers, a monitor to check the connection state, and an operating part to manage the entire process. The portable optical fiber processing apparatus allows for stripping sheathing, cutting, and welding of optical fibers using a single device, streamlining the processing workflow.
